The fetch is normally far too small for southeasterly winds to supply great surf. There are more than 20 named breaks in Untrue Bay. The north-wester can have an extended fetch and may create huge waves, However they may be related to neighborhood wind and be incredibly poorly sorted. The Atlantic Coastline is subjected to the full ability of your South-westerly swell made by the westerly winds of your southern ocean, often a great distance away, Therefore the swell has time to independent into related wavelengths, and there are several globe course big wave breaks among the named breaks from the Atlantic shore.[260][261][262]

beneath apartheid, the Cape was considered a "Coloured labour choice area", towards the exclusion of "Bantus", i.e. Black Africans. The implementation of this policy was extensively opposed by trade unions, civil Modern society and opposition functions. it is actually notable that this policy was not advocated for by any Coloured political group, and its implementation was a unilateral determination because of the apartheid government.

In summer months False Bay is thermally stratified, that has a vertical temperature variation of 5 to nine˚C amongst the hotter surface area drinking water and cooler depths below 50 m, even though in Wintertime the drinking water column is at virtually consistent temperature whatsoever depths. the event of the thermocline is strongest about late December and peaks in late summer to early autumn.

minimal is thought from the background with the location's initial people, because there isn't a published historical past from the area in advance of it had been very first described by Portuguese explorer Bartolomeu Dias. Dias, the main European to get to the place, arrived in 1488 and named it "Cape of Storms" (Cabo das Tormentas).
